Burning Sky Brewery

Burning Sky is an independent farmhouse brewery based on the Firle Estate in the foothills of the South Downs. Founded in 2013 by former Dark Star head brewer Mark Tranter, the brewery is known for hop-forward pale ales, Belgian-inspired farmhouse beers and an extensive programme of barrel-aged and mixed-fermentation releases.

About Burning Sky Brewery

Burning Sky began with the ambition of creating a brewer-led brewery dedicated to both expressive, hop-forward pale ales and the traditions of Belgian farmhouse brewing. Founded by experienced brewer Mark Tranter, the brewery produced its first beer in the autumn of 2013 using a 15-barrel brewing plant.

The brewery is based in refurbished farm buildings on the Firle Estate, beneath the South Downs in East Sussex. Its rural setting and close connection to the surrounding landscape have helped shape Burning Sky's identity as a genuine farmhouse brewery.

From the beginning, Burning Sky has combined traditional brewing practices with modern techniques and flavours. The brewery maintains its own yeast strains, selected to suit the different beer styles it produces, and is particularly recognised for its pale ales, saisons and Belgian-inspired beers.

An extensive barrel-ageing and mixed-fermentation programme forms an important part of the brewery's work, allowing beers to develop slowly in wood with fruit, wild yeast and carefully selected cultures. Burning Sky remains independently owned and operated by a small team, continuing its original aim of producing distinctive, world-class beer across a wide range of styles and formats.

Beak Brewery

Beak Brewery is an independent craft brewery based in Lewes, East Sussex, producing modern hop-forward beers alongside crisp lagers, pilsners, barrel-aged releases and rich imperial stouts. Founded as a nomadic brewing project before establishing a permanent home in 2020, Beak has become one of the UK's most respected modern breweries, pairing innovative brewing with a vibrant taproom, community events and a strong focus on freshness and quality.

Long Man Brewery

Long Man Brewery is an independent East Sussex brewery based at Church Farm in Litlington, in the heart of the South Downs National Park. Brewing since 2012, it produces balanced, highly drinkable cask and keg beers using regeneratively farmed barley grown beside the brewery, locally sourced ingredients and environmentally responsible brewing methods.
